Packaging This is a re-release of Shin Getter Robot Black Version with nightglow from Miracle House, a subsidiary of Aoshima. The package contents come protected in Styrofoam where its parts are stored at both sides of the box (top and bottom). The box design is a bit inconvenient as I need to flip box over and the parts from the opposite side might drop from its intended location. The following are the listing of the contents. |

Figure
The Shin Getter Black has an excellent paint job. It is
colored in glossy black, gunmetal, gold and silver. There is
a clear plastic part on chest that reveals inner chest
details. The inner details glow in the night. Other
nightglow parts are found on its axe blade, hidden belt
cannon and head patterns.
The figure is very heavy hinted the amount of metal composition. If I am not mistaken, there are only 5% non-metal parts found on the figure that are as listed below.
- Head
- Clear Chest Part
- Axe Blade with night glow (Handles are metal)
- Wings
- Extra Hands

Articulations
The figure has a great upper torso movement comparing to
its lower. The figure small head rotates with neck moveable
up and down. Its shoulder has free movement in all direction
with click joints. The upper and lower arms rotate. The
elbows are extensible revealing joints that rotate and bend
90 degrees. This is has to purposes. In non-extended mode,
the arms look like the anime robot and whereas the extended
elbows are to give the figure a much more range of movement
in its axe wielding pose.
The lower torso has limited movement in overall. Both hips come with free movement in all directions although limited. Its knee rotates and bends backward at about 30 degrees. Both feet rotate with a limited 10 to 15 degree sideway.
I do not blame on the general lack of movement range on its lower torso as the figure is too heavy and delicate to pose in extreme.

Conclusion
In overall, this is a great die-cast figure that comes
along with a solid paint job. However, there are a few
qualms that I have on this item. There is no display base
provided for this marvelous figure. Unlike current Bandai's
SOC range of figure, there is no plugs to cover up the
screws at the back of the figure.
